Insider Activity Spotlight: Cognex Corp’s Latest Deal

The most recent form 4 filing shows Vice President Long Darren Marc buying 2,500 shares of Cognex Corp. on August 7, 2026 at roughly $63 per share – a modest uptick against the current market price of $62.90. The purchase is part of a broader pattern of mixed insider trading: while Marc has sold a total of 734 shares at $66.89 to cover tax withholding on restricted units, he has also sold sizable blocks of common stock in May 2026, most notably a 4,500‑share block at $56.44 and an 8,675‑share block at $51.49. The net effect of the latest transaction is a slight increase in his ownership stake, bringing his post‑deal holdings to 6,490 shares.

Long Darren Marc: A Transaction Profile

Over the past three years, Marc’s insider activity has been characterized by frequent option and restricted‑stock transactions. He has accumulated more than 30 000 non‑qualified stock options and roughly 20 000 restricted units, and has executed over 20 common‑stock trades (both buys and sells). His pattern is typical of a senior executive who uses options and RSUs to align interests with shareholders, while occasionally selling shares to meet tax or liquidity needs. The recent sale of 734 shares to cover tax on vested RSUs reflects routine corporate practice rather than a signal of distress. The net result is a modest, but steady, increase in his equity stake.
